The Historical Gate of Gwalior: Ladheri Gate



The Ladheri Gate of Gwalior is one of the historic gateways to the city, located in the Madhya Pradesh state of India. Built during the rule of the Tomar dynasty in the 15th century, the gate served as a prominent entrance to the city and was used as a strategic defense point.

The Ladheri Gate is known for its architectural beauty and intricate design, showcasing a blend of Hindu and Islamic styles. The gate features ornate carvings, arches, and domes that reflect the craftsmanship of the time period. The intricately carved motifs and patterns add to the grandeur of the structure.

Over the years, the Ladheri Gate has undergone several renovations and restorations to maintain its historical significance. The gate stands as a symbol of the rich cultural heritage and architectural marvels of Gwalior.
